Output 3857d30f3a3fe1702e88701bca7dadb4ddb843bf50b39d5220db0bb0a7997148:0

value
31442604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ad75709bcbe52b38203e3e21070531ebac370c74 OP_EQUAL
address
3HWBWbXftmzwwXXLgntos98e5i5cGSo1cq
transaction
3857d30f3a3fe1702e88701bca7dadb4ddb843bf50b39d5220db0bb0a7997148
spent
true